## Build Provenance: Event Schema Registry

Every schema published to the Gravelight registry carries provenance metadata linking it to the build that produced it. For release managers: before promoting a schema version to production, confirm the provenance record matches a signed pipeline run — unsigned schemas are rejected by the Mistfall consumers automatically. Manual uploads are disabled in all environments. The current production registry build is identified immediately below.

build token for kagaf-hahof: htk14_9d3d4d26d7d8de

## Formula sandbox tuning

User-supplied formulas in Gridmoor execute inside a restricted interpreter with hard ceilings on time, memory, and call depth. Reviewers should confirm any change to these ceilings is justified in the PR description, since raising them widens the abuse surface. Defaults were chosen from production traces. The current limits are as follows.

limits module of tafog-fawip:
WEIGHTS = {
    "julix": 57,
    "lamys": 992,
    "kasvan": 209,
    "quenok": 750,
    "alddor": 259,
    "oliath": 1009,
    "wenix": 815,
}

The rebuild scheduler tracks content fingerprints in a small relational database, and plugins that register custom dependency edges must be able to read and write this table during local runs. Run `sb migrate` once to create the schema, then start the watcher with `sb dev --incremental`. Confirm that dirty-page detection works by editing any source file. Your local watcher should connect to the fingerprint database using the connection string below.

replica DSN, kajep-yahag: mssql://praok_svc:iF@db-8d68.plorvaio.local:5432/eliion